Brief summary

This study aims to examine the associations of interoceptive awareness and interoceptive accuracy with plantar superficial sensory threshold, knee joint proprioception, pain intensity, and dynamic balance performance in cognitively intact individuals with chronic hemiplegia. Hypotheses are: * H0: There is no significant relationship between interoception and light touch, proprioception, pain, or dynamic balance performance in cognitively intact individuals with chronic hemiplegia. * H1: There is a significant relationship between interoception and light touch, proprioception, pain, or dynamic balance performance in cognitively intact individuals with chronic hemiplegia All participants will undergo a single assessment session and will not be invited for any treatment or follow-up evaluation. Participants will not take any intervention.

Inclusion criteria

* Presence of hemiplegia due to a physician-diagnosed stroke, * At least 6 months have passed since the stroke, * Voluntary agreement to participate in the study.

Exclusion criteria

* History of traumatic brain injury, brain tumor, meningitis, or secondary neurological disease, * Having experienced a cardiovascular event or any acute medical condition within the last 3 months, * Insufficient visual or auditory ability to understand the questionnaires and tests.

Design outcomes

Primary

MeasureTime frameDescription
Interoceptive AwarenessDay 1The Multidimensional Assessment of Interoceptive Awareness Version 2 (MAIA-2) consists of eight subscales, each scored from 0 to 5. Higher scores indicate greater interoceptive awareness in the corresponding domain.
Interoceptive AccuracyDay 1Heartbeat Counting Task
Proprioception AssessmentDay 1Joint Position Reconstruction Test for the 45 degrees knee flexion.
Functional Mobility and BalanceDay 1Timed-up and Go Test
Functional Lower Extremity StrengthDay 15 Times Sit-to-Stand Test

Secondary

MeasureTime frameDescription
Light Touch SensationDay 1Semmes-Weinstein Monofilament Test on the plantar surface of the foot
Subjective PainDay 1The Numeric Rating Scale for Lower Extremity Pain Severity is an 11-point scale ranging from 0 to 10, where 0 indicates no pain and 10 indicates the worst pain imaginable. Higher scores indicate greater pain severity.
Fear of FallingDay 1The Falls Efficacy Scale-International (FES-I) consists of 16 items, with a total score ranging from 16 to 64. Higher scores indicate greater concern about falling (greater fear of falling).
